Technical Specifications Breakdown
The 200150-15-05 offers key performance parameters essential for accurate vibration measurement:
- Sensitivity: 10.2 mV/(m/s²) (100 mV/g) at 80 Hz, with ±12% tolerance
- Measurement Range: ±245 m/s² (±25 g) for acceleration; 14.7 mm/s² (1.5 mg) for low-level vibration
- Frequency Range: 10 to 1000 Hz (600 to 60,000 cpm), referenced to 80 Hz with ±10% tolerance
- Mounted Resonant Frequency: >20 kHz (>1200 kcpm)
- Amplitude Linearity: ±2% (1 to 10 g pk)
- Transverse Sensitivity: ≤7%
- Settling Time: ≤300 ms (within 5% of bias)
- Excitation Voltage: 4.7 to 5.5 Vdc
- Quiescent Current: <800 µA
- Output Bias Voltage: +2.5 ± 0.23 Vdc
- Axial Shock Limit: 49,050 m/s² pk (5,000 g pk)
- Temperature Range: -40 ºC to +105 ºC (-40 ºF to +221 ºF)
- Sealing: Hermetic, 5X10⁻⁸ atm•cc/s maximum
- Relative Humidity: 100% relative, condensing, non-submerged

Installation & Setup Guidance
Proper mounting is essential for accurate readings. The accelerometer features a 3/8-24 female mounting thread. Use the included stud option (15 = 3/8-24 to 3/8-16 UNC, 3/4 inch hex stud) for secure attachment. Apply a mounting torque of 2.7 to 6.8 N•m (2 to 5 ft•lbf) to ensure consistent coupling.
For best results, mount the accelerometer on a clean, flat surface directly on the machine housing. Avoid mounting on painted or uneven surfaces. The settling time of ≤300 ms allows quick stabilization after power-up.

Compatibility & Integration
This accelerometer works with Bently Nevada Trendmaster systems, specifically the ProTIM option with Standard Acceleration-to-Velocity channel type (-01).
